Understanding Cost Drivers in Plastic Packaging

Material Selection and Production Expenses

The cost of plastic packaging is heavily influenced by the choice of materials like polyethylene (PE), polypropylene (PP), and polyvinyl chloride (PVC). These are among the most commonly used materials due to their durability and versatility. However, the cost of these raw materials can fluctuate widely. For instance, market demand and global supply issues often cause variations in raw material costs. According to industry reports, such fluctuations have been particularly pronounced in recent years, with prices shifting based on economic and geopolitical factors. Selecting the right material not only impacts the aesthetic and functional quality of the packaging but also its overall production cost. Larger production volumes generally allow for economies of scale, which can reduce per-unit costs significantly. Therefore, material selection, influenced by these economic variables, becomes a key factor in managing production expenses.

Manufacturing Processes Affecting Budgets

The manufacturing processes used in plastic packaging, such as extrusion, injection molding, and thermoforming, are significant considerations in budgeting. Each of these processes incurs different costs, depending on the complexity and duration required. For example, the efficiency of these processes directly impacts labor and overhead expenses, leading to potential cost savings or overruns. Evidence from case studies in the industry demonstrates that automated processes often lead to reduced expenses over time compared to manual processes. However, initial investment costs can be substantial for automation. Additionally, another crucial aspect in budgeting for plastic packaging is the cost implications tied to waste management. Efficient manufacturing processes will minimize waste generation, thus further reducing material costs. Effective budget management in plastic packaging production requires careful consideration of these manufacturing elements and their associated costs.

Durability Considerations for Long-Term Value

Impact Resistance in Transit

The durability of packaging is crucial to ensure goods reach their destination without damage, highlighting the importance of impact resistance during transit and storage. Plastic packaging excels in this area, providing exceptional protection against impacts, thereby reducing damage rates. For instance, studies in logistics and shipping have revealed that inadequate impact protection can significantly increase damage and return rates, adversely affecting the supply chain's efficiency. Material choices such as polyethylene (PE) or polypropylene (PP) and innovations in packaging design, like reinforced structures or shock-absorbing layers, are pivotal in enhancing impact resistance. This durability not only protects products but also cultivates consumer trust, as it ensures delivery of goods in pristine condition.

Weatherproofing and Moisture Barriers

Weatherproofing constitutes an essential component of packaging solutions, safeguarding goods from environmental factors like rain, humidity, and temperature fluctuations. Effective weatherproofing extends the shelf life and maintains the quality of products, which is crucial across various industries. Utilization of moisture barriers, through the application of specialized coatings or films such as polyethylene terephthalate (PET), significantly mitigates the risk of moisture ingress. Research has shown that moisture-resistant packaging plays a significant role in preserving product integrity, particularly in sensitive sectors like electronics and pharmaceuticals. By integrating advanced materials and techniques, businesses can enhance the protective attributes of their packaging, thereby ensuring long-term value and reducing the likelihood of spoilage or product degradation.

Strategies for Balancing Budget and Longevity

Optimizing Material Thickness

Optimizing material thickness is a strategic approach that can lead to significant cost savings and enhanced durability in packaging solutions. By carefully assessing the required material thickness for different applications, companies can reduce material waste while maintaining the strength needed to protect products. For instance, leading packaging companies have successfully implemented optimization strategies, such as using thinner yet stronger materials, to achieve both economic efficiency and product safety. Expert opinions suggest that conducting thorough testing and analysis is essential to determine the optimal thickness for various packaging needs, balancing cost-effectiveness with durability.

Integrating Recyclable Components

Integrating recyclable components in packaging not only supports sustainability but also offers cost efficiency as a core benefit. By utilizing recyclable materials, companies can lower their environmental impact and potentially reduce packaging costs through improved material management and recycling incentives. Studies show that higher recycling rates can significantly diminish overall packaging expenses. A prominent example includes businesses that have successfully integrated recyclable materials without compromising quality, demonstrating that sustainable practices can be economically viable. This integration aligns with consumer preferences, as a growing number of buyers demand eco-friendly packaging options that reflect their environmental concerns.
